5 Reasons to Choose Engineered Wood Flooring For your Home

Considering an upgrade to your home's flooring or tackling a renovation? You're likely weighing various options, each with its own set of benefits and drawbacks. Few choices stand the test of time like engineered wood flooring. Here, we share five reasons why it should be at the top of your list.

1. Longevity & durability

Engineered wood flooring when well maintained can last for decades. Thanks to its multi-layered construction, the core of its design strengthens the boards resilience helping it to withstand fluctuations in both humidity and moisture. Finishes such as lacquer add an extra layer of protection where accidents are inevitable, making scratches and spills less of a worry, even in the busiest areas of your home. Built to handle everyday wear and tear, engineered wood flooring is an ideal option for high-traffic areas and busy family homes.

3. Ease of cleaning & maintenance

Modern wood flooring, particularly engineered wood with contemporary finishes, is surprisingly low maintenance and designed for everyday life. While solid wood requires more care against moisture, engineered wood offers greater resilience. The durability of oak, combined with our robust finishes, provides significant protection against daily wear.

Lacquered finishes act as a strong barrier, prized for their ease of cleaning and minimal upkeep. Oiled finishes, while requiring periodic reapplication, offer easy spot repair. Plus, the ability to sand and refinish your engineered wood floor means that after years of enjoyment, it can be restored to its original beauty, giving you a fresh start without a replacement.

4. Timeless appeal

Investing in engineered wood flooring helps to future proof your home, offering a timeless appeal as trends evolve. With a range of styles, grades and finishes to choose from there's an option to suit every interior style. 

Straight planks are a timeless choice, offering simplicity and versatility that works beautifully in any interior, from modern to rustic. On the other hand, herringbone patterns bring a touch of character and sophistication to a room. Perfect for both traditional and contemporary interiors, this pattern can subtly define areas in open-plan layouts, such as separating a dining space from the living room.
